Programme Coordinator/Trainer
Training & Development: CDETB Programme
Specified purpose contract Clerical Grade V full-time 35 hours per week (Monday to Sunday roster). Flexibility to work some evening & weekends is essential. This role will be based in Raheny and CRC Community Hubs.
A vacancy has arisen for the above post on our QQI Level 3 Employability Skills Programme in Adult Services, CRC. In line with New Directions policy 2012, the programme supports adults with disabilities in obtaining the necessary academic knowledge, skills, experience and confidence to lead self-determined lives within their community.
The Programme Coordinator/Trainer will coordinate the daily operation of the CDETB funded QQI programme in Raheny. The candidate will be required to deliver nonaccredited and accredited modules, ranging from QQI Level 1 – 4 in various modules such as Communications, Literacy and Numeracy, Computer Literacy and Application of Number. In addition to delivering training, the successful candidate will be responsible for supporting a team of trainers and support workers.
The candidate must demonstrate the following essential competencies;
- a relevant 3rd level qualification (e.g. Social Studies, Education, Training, Management or a related discipline) QQI Level 8 or above
- a relevant pedagogical qualification QQI Level 6 or above
- working knowledge of the Interim Standards for New Directions, Services and Supports for Adults with Disabilities and the HSE Safeguarding of Vulnerable Adults Policy.
- a minimum of two years relevant experience working within an educational setting and providing training to adults with a disability
- a minimum of two years’ experience of co-ordinating a work-team is desirable
- experience and knowledge of operating a QQI system and/or TQAS policies and procedures
- excellent written and verbal communications skills
- awareness of health & safety issues
- IT skills to include Excel and Microsoft Office
- commitment to the to the empowerment of people who have a disability
- Full Clean drivers’ licence
Department of Health Salary applies Clerical Grade, code 0566 (€51,206 - €61,253).
